Technical Specifications and Design Principles
The design philosophy behind a modern pilates aluminium reformer prioritizes structural integrity, operational fluidity, and ergonomic adaptability. Critical components include aircraft-grade aluminum frames, precision-machined carriages, and an advanced spring system. Aluminum, particularly alloys such as 6061-T6 or 7075, is chosen for its superior strength-to-weight ratio, excellent corrosion resistance, and ability to be extruded and CNC machined to incredibly tight tolerances.
The carriage system, often equipped with eight-wheel constant velocity mechanisms, utilizes sealed bearings to ensure an exceptionally smooth, quiet, and consistent glide. This reduces friction and wear, extending the machine's operational lifespan. Adjustable components, such as footbars, spring resistance, and shoulder rests, are designed for quick, secure adjustments, accommodating a diverse range of user heights and physical capabilities. Upholstery is typically marine-grade vinyl, chosen for its durability, hygiene, and resistance to wear and tear in high-traffic environments.

Manufacturing Process and Quality Assurance
The production of a high-quality pilates aluminium reformer involves a precise multi-stage manufacturing process, ensuring both aesthetic appeal and structural integrity.
Process Flow:
- Material Sourcing & Selection: High-grade aluminum ingots or extrusions are rigorously inspected for metallurgical composition and purity, ensuring compliance with international standards such as ASTM B221 (for extruded bars, rods, wire, shapes) or relevant ISO standards for raw materials.
- Precision Cutting & Forming: Aluminum profiles are cut to exact specifications using automated saws. Complex parts, like the carriage tracks or specialized connectors, undergo CNC machining to achieve micron-level precision, critical for smooth operation and perfect alignment.
- Welding & Assembly of Frame: Frame components are carefully joined using TIG (Tungsten Inert Gas) welding, known for its strong, clean welds and minimal distortion. Robotic welding systems may be employed for consistency. Post-welding, frames are inspected for structural integrity and dimensional accuracy.
- Surface Treatment: The aluminum frame undergoes anodizing, an electrochemical passivation process that increases the thickness of the natural oxide layer on the metal surface. This enhances corrosion resistance, wear resistance, and allows for various aesthetic finishes, preventing oxidation and maintaining a pristine look.
- Component Manufacturing: Springs are manufactured from high-tensile steel, often nickel-plated for corrosion resistance and calibrated for precise resistance levels. Upholstery is cut and sewn, often with reinforced stitching, using durable, easy-to-clean materials. Wheels, bearings, ropes, and other accessories are also produced or sourced under strict quality controls.
- Final Assembly: All sub-components are integrated. This includes attaching the carriage, spring system, footbar, risers, and pulleys. Each connection point is checked for proper torque and alignment.
- Testing & Quality Control: Every reformer undergoes rigorous testing. This includes load testing for carriage and frame integrity (e.g., 2x maximum user weight), functional testing of all moving parts (smoothness, noise levels), spring calibration verification, and safety checks for pinch points or sharp edges. Products must comply with international safety standards like CE EN 957-1/2 for stationary training equipment and potentially ISO 20957 for general fitness equipment.
- Packaging: Reformers are securely packed, often using custom-fit foam and reinforced cartons, to prevent damage during transit.
The typical service life of a well-maintained pilates aluminium reformer in a commercial setting is 10-15 years, significantly longer than many alternative materials due to aluminum's inherent durability and resistance to environmental factors. For home use, this lifespan can extend even further.

Technical Advantages:
- Exceptional Durability and Longevity: Aluminum frames are highly resistant to impact, scratches, and bending, far surpassing the resilience of wood frames in high-usage environments. Anodization further protects against corrosion, making them suitable for humid climates or areas where equipment might be frequently cleaned with disinfectants.
- Lightweight and Portability: While sturdy, aluminum is significantly lighter than steel, and often lighter than solid hardwoods used in pilates wood reformer models. This facilitates easier repositioning, especially for models designed with wheels or folding mechanisms, enhancing versatility in studio layouts or multi-purpose spaces.
- Precision and Consistency: CNC machined aluminum components allow for extremely tight tolerances, ensuring perfect alignment of tracks and wheels. This translates to an ultra-smooth, silent, and consistent carriage glide, which is paramount for effective Pilates instruction and therapeutic outcomes.
- Hygienic and Easy Maintenance: Non-porous anodized aluminum surfaces are inherently more hygienic and easier to clean and disinfect compared to natural wood, which can absorb moisture and require more specialized care.
- Modern Aesthetic: The sleek, metallic finish of aluminum offers a contemporary, tech-savvy look that complements modern interior designs, appealing to clients who value cutting-edge equipment and aesthetics.
